source from: Pixabay
引言:JS特效模板,网页开发的创意加速器
在数字化时代,网页开发不仅仅是静态内容的展示,更是交互体验的较量。JS特效模板,作为网页开发中不可或缺的工具,以其丰富的功能和应用场景,成为提升用户体验的利器。本文将深入探讨JS特效模板的种类、应用场景和优势,带领读者领略其在网页开发中的重要性,激发对这一领域的深入探索。在这里,我们不仅将揭示JS特效模板的奥秘,更将展示其如何成为网页开发的创意加速器。让我们一起踏上这场探索之旅,开启JS特效模板的精彩世界。
一、JS特效模板的基础概念
1、什么是JS特效模板
JS特效模板,顾名思义,是使用JavaScript编写的用于实现网页动态交互效果的代码片段。它们可以帮助开发者快速、高效地在网页上实现各种动画、验证、展示等功能,而无需从头编写复杂的JavaScript代码。随着网页开发技术的不断发展,JS特效模板在提高开发效率、降低开发成本方面发挥着越来越重要的作用。
2、JS特效模板的工作原理
JS特效模板通常基于JavaScript、HTML和CSS等技术实现。其工作原理如下:
- HTML: 定义网页的基本结构,包括元素、标签和属性。
- CSS: 负责网页的样式设计,包括颜色、字体、布局等。
- JavaScript: 通过脚本实现网页的动态效果,如动画、验证等。
JS特效模板将HTML、CSS和JavaScript结合起来,形成一个完整的动态效果,实现网页的交互性。
3、常见JS特效模板的类型
常见的JS特效模板包括以下几种:
类型 | 功能描述 |
---|---|
导航菜单 | 实现网页的菜单效果,提供方便的导航功能 |
图片展示 | 用于展示图片、轮播图等,增加网页的视觉效果 |
表单验证 | 实现表单数据的验证,确保数据的准确性 |
按钮动画 | 为按钮添加动态效果,提升用户体验 |
动画库 | 提供丰富的动画效果,方便开发者快速实现动画效果 |
窗口弹层 | 用于显示弹层,如提示信息、登录界面等 |
网页特效 | 用于实现网页的动态效果,如粒子效果、3D效果等 |
这些JS特效模板可以根据实际需求进行选择和搭配,为网页开发提供便捷。
二、JS特效模板的应用场景
在网页开发中,JS特效模板的应用场景十分广泛,几乎涵盖了网页设计的各个方面。以下是一些常见的应用场景:
1、在网站导航中的应用
网站导航是用户浏览网站的重要途径,一个美观且实用的导航菜单可以提升用户体验。JS特效模板可以轻松实现各种导航菜单效果,如下拉菜单、折叠菜单、标签页等。以下是一些具体的应用示例:
导航菜单类型 | 特效模板应用 |
---|---|
下拉菜单 | 使用CSS3动画实现平滑的展开和收起效果 |
折叠菜单 | 通过JavaScript控制菜单的展开和收起 |
标签页 | 实现标签页的切换效果,方便用户快速定位所需内容 |
2、在图片展示中的运用
图片展示是网站中常见的元素,通过JS特效模板可以制作出丰富的图片展示效果,如轮播图、图片放大镜、图片缩略图等。以下是一些具体的应用示例:
图片展示类型 | 特效模板应用 |
---|---|
轮播图 | 使用JavaScript和CSS实现图片的自动播放和手动切换 |
图片放大镜 | 通过鼠标悬停放大图片局部,方便用户查看细节 |
图片缩略图 | 使用CSS实现图片的缩放和点击查看大图效果 |
3、在表单验证中的功能
表单验证是保证用户输入数据准确性的重要手段,JS特效模板可以轻松实现各种表单验证效果,如实时提示、错误提示、验证成功提示等。以下是一些具体的应用示例:
表单验证类型 | 特效模板应用 |
---|---|
实时提示 | 使用JavaScript实时检测用户输入,给出相应的提示信息 |
错误提示 | 使用CSS和JavaScript实现错误信息的弹出和提示 |
验证成功提示 | 使用CSS动画展示验证成功的提示信息 |
4、在按钮动画中的效果
按钮是网站中常见的交互元素,通过JS特效模板可以制作出丰富的按钮动画效果,如点击反馈、悬停效果、加载动画等。以下是一些具体的应用示例:
按钮动画类型 | 特效模板应用 |
---|---|
点击反馈 | 使用CSS和JavaScript实现按钮点击时的动态效果 |
悬停效果 | 使用CSS动画实现按钮悬停时的动态效果 |
加载动画 | 使用CSS和JavaScript实现按钮加载时的动态效果 |
通过以上应用场景的介绍,可以看出JS特效模板在网页开发中的重要作用。合理运用JS特效模板,可以提升网站的交互性和用户体验,为用户带来更好的浏览体验。
三、使用JS特效模板的优势
使用JS特效模板可以带来多方面的优势,以下列举了三个主要优势:
1、提高开发效率
在网页开发过程中,实现某些特效需要编写大量的JavaScript代码。使用JS特效模板,开发者可以直接调用这些预定义的代码片段,省去了从头开始编写的时间,从而大大提高了开发效率。以下是一个简单的表格,展示了使用JS特效模板与手动编写代码的时间对比:
特效类型 | 使用JS特效模板所需时间 | 手动编写代码所需时间 |
---|---|---|
导航菜单 | 5分钟 | 30分钟 |
图片展示 | 10分钟 | 60分钟 |
按钮动画 | 15分钟 | 90分钟 |
从上表可以看出,使用JS特效模板可以节省大量时间,尤其是在项目开发周期紧张的情况下,这一优势更加明显。
2、增强用户体验
JS特效模板能够实现丰富的动态效果,如动画、过渡、提示框等,这些效果能够提升用户体验。以下是一些使用JS特效模板增强用户体验的例子:
- 轮播图:在图片展示页面使用轮播图,用户可以通过点击按钮或滑动屏幕浏览图片。
- 表单验证:在表单提交时,使用JS特效模板实现实时验证,提示用户输入错误信息。
- 导航菜单:使用动画效果使导航菜单更具有视觉吸引力,方便用户操作。
3、兼容性和可扩展性
JS特效模板通常经过优化,以确保在各种浏览器和设备上都能正常运行。此外,由于这些模板通常遵循一定的设计规范,开发者可以轻松地对其进行修改和扩展,以满足不同的需求。以下是一些提高兼容性和可扩展性的措施:
- 使用标准的HTML、CSS和JavaScript代码:确保代码兼容主流浏览器。
- 遵循模块化设计:将代码划分为多个模块,方便维护和扩展。
- 使用预处理器:如Sass、Less等,提高CSS代码的可读性和可维护性。
总之,使用JS特效模板可以帮助开发者提高开发效率、增强用户体验,并确保网站的兼容性和可扩展性。对于追求高质量网页体验的开发者来说,JS特效模板是一个不可或缺的工具。
结语:拥抱JS特效模板,提升网页交互体验
结语:拥抱JS特效模板,提升网页交互体验
在这个数字化时代,网页交互体验已经成为网站成功的关键因素。JS特效模板作为提升网页交互性的重要工具,其重要性和应用价值不言而喻。通过使用JS特效模板,开发者可以轻松实现各种动态效果,提高开发效率,降低开发成本。同时,合理的运用JS特效模板还能增强用户体验,提高网站的竞争力。
我们鼓励开发者积极拥抱JS特效模板,不断探索和尝试各种模板,为用户提供更加丰富、更加人性化的交互体验。在未来的网页开发中,JS特效模板将继续发挥重要作用,成为开发者不可或缺的助手。让我们携手共进,共同创造更加美好的网络世界。
常见问题
-
JS特效模板是否需要付费使用?JS特效模板的使用是否付费取决于具体的选择。市面上有免费和付费的JS特效模板,免费模板通常功能较为基础,而付费模板可能提供更多高级功能和更全面的客户支持。
-
如何选择合适的JS特效模板?选择JS特效模板时,首先要考虑模板的兼容性、易用性和功能是否满足项目需求。同时,也可以参考社区评价和实际演示效果,以确保选择最适合自己项目的模板。
-
JS特效模板对网站性能有何影响?合理使用JS特效模板通常不会对网站性能产生负面影响。但若过度使用或选择性能不佳的模板,可能会影响网站加载速度。因此,选择轻量级、性能优良的模板至关重要。
-
初学者如何快速上手JS特效模板?对于初学者,可以从以下几个步骤入手:
- 学习基础的JavaScript知识。
- 选择一个适合自己的JS特效模板。
- 阅读模板的文档和示例代码。
- 逐步实践和修改,直到熟悉模板的使用方法。
原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/121094.html